Articles I, II, and III of the U. S. Constitution divide the power of the federal government into three branches. What are the three branches of government and which article established each branch? What is the term that describes this division of power? Legislative Branch - Article I. Executive Branch - Article II. every 2 years. What are the 3 requirements listed for house members? At least 25 years old. US citizen for at least 7 years. Resident of the state in which they reside. Who is the presiding officer of the House of Representatives? Speaker of the House. Article I Section 8 of the Constitution lists the powers of Congress. List 5 of these powers. Some of the powers of Congress are to make and collect taxes; borrow money; regulate commerce; coin money; establish post- office; declare war; etc.Procedures. INTRODUCTION: View the video...30 y/o. who is the president of the senate and when may that person vote? The Vice President, when a tie is needed to break. What legislative body has the power of impeachment and which body has the power to try an impeached official? The HOR has the power to impeach, and the senate tried the official.
